Team,

Orders in Larkpond now use soft deletes. `deleted_at` replaces hard DELETEs; all reads must filter on it. The ORM scope handles this — don't write raw queries against `orders` without it. Backfill finished last night; old rows are tombstoned, not gone. Questions go to the data channel. Verified against build:

build token for yajop-kawif: htk21_21d141fe127ea0a15af2b

**Ticket: Pointsmere ledger — staging env misconfigured**

Staging ledger writes are failing with auth errors since Tuesday's rotation. Root cause: `.env` on the staging ledger host still carries last cycle's settings. `POINTSMERE_LEDGER_URL` and `POINTSMERE_REGION` were corrected this morning; accrual jobs still blocked. Remaining fix: the rotated ledger write secret needs to be placed on the next line of the file.

sealed setting: RELAY_SECRET5=82864

TURN-208: Gatevale turnstile counters at the Merrow Field pilot double-count when a rotation reverses mid-cycle. Attendance totals drift roughly 2% high per event. The debounce window fix is implemented, reviewed by Ilsa, and soak-tested across two simulated match days without drift. Ready for your cut; the candidate build is identified below.

trace token, tagag-tafog: htk6_5ed18c

**Mgmt Meeting Minutes — Retiring the Brightline Range**

Quick recap for sales leads at Fenholt Supplies: we agreed to retire the Brightline fixture range by year-end. Remaining stock moves to clearance pricing next month, and accounts on standing orders get migrated to the Lumetta range. Trade-in incentives were approved in principle. The confidential note on next steps sits just below.

board note of bajof-bajeg: The pricing group signed off on a budget of $13.4 million for Project Sildor. The renewal with Lamixek Holdings closes at $48.9 million a year, 49 percent above the last contract.